Properties of Vinegar - Density of Vinegar; The density, or mass per unit volume, of a solution is used in many analytical calculations and can be measured with a hydrometer.; For a typical commercial vinegar with a 5% acetic acid content, the density is about 1.01 grams per milliliter.

Experiment 1 Determination of the Acetic Acid Content of Vinegar.; Pipette accurately, using a pipette filler, 10.00 cm3 of vinegar into a 100 cm3 volumetric flask, make up to the bottom of the stem using distilled water, mix well then make up to the mark and mix again.

Methanoic acid, ethanoic acid and propanoic acid (particularly ethanoic acid) are the main volatile acidic components in the vinegar, whereas acids such as tartaric acid, succinic acid and citric acid are among those which account for the non-volatile components.
